Experiment Date Wiki & reports Model Other details
PrimEx Oct-Nov 2021?? PrimEx_instructions
  • GPR, trained on GlueX-2020
  • Default HV 2125V
  • HV predictions were rounded to nearest 5V
  • Shifters ran the scripts to read EPICS and suggest HV, before setting HV and starting the run
  • Much of the run was with empty target. Shifters were not supposed to use the AI w empty tgt but they did.
  • The shifters were not asked to set the HV to 2125V before running the AI. This was not ideal, but saved time.
Cosmics March 2022 Cosmics_test_plans
  • GPR, trained on GlueX-2020 + PrimEx2021
  • Default HV 2130V
  • HVB current fixed at 9A
  • Temp fixed at 299K??? at start of run
  • HV predictions rounded to nearest 1V
  • RoboCDC ran autonomously, setting the HV every 5 minutes.
  • Half of the CDC was kept at fixed default HV.
  • Temp fixed at 299 or 300K until FDC LV brought temp into trained region
CPP June 2022 CPP plans
  • GPR with MLP (multilayer perceptron) learned prior, trained on GlueX-2020 + PrimEx2021
  • Uncertainty quantification used to determine when to return to the comfort zone (3%: is threshold for standard_deviation_of_prediction/ideal_GCF)
  • Default HV 2125V
  • HV predictions rounded to nearest 1V
  • /group/halld/AIEC/utilities/CDC_control_ai/ cpp/d_cdc_modelneeds/gpflow_params.pkl
  • RoboCDC summoned by DAQ 'GO' to read EPICS and set HV.
  • RoboCDC scaled the HVB current reading to what it would have been at the default HV, before predicting GCF.
  • Overall on/off switch added to CDC HV control gui.
